Just about the most important tools in database and application design is known as ER Diagram Markdown. This can be used powerful tool to design databases and to get in touch with users as well as other stakeholders inside a project. It is possible to download an effective illustration of this kind of diagram right here on the site.
So that you can fully understand what you are actually seeing, read through this short explanation of entity relationship diagrams and why they can be so useful.
Precisely What Is ER Diagram Markdown?
These kinds of diagram displays entities and the properties that every one of these entities have. Typically, each entity is represented from a box on the diagram, and the properties are within or near the box. In turn, additionally, it displays the partnership between each one of these entities. The partnership is often drawn using a line between entities.
People without a lot of technical knowledge can typically understand this particular diagram easily, and that is certainly one among its main benefits. It can help iron out of the design before the development team has now committed to a design. It can also be used to code the database and also to communicate in regards to the nature in the database with a variety of those who are involved in the project.
To understand this more fully, they are some quick definitions:
* Entity: An entity identifies an item, typically a person, place, or thing. By way of example, an auto might be an entity for the auto dealership.
* Entity properties: Each entity has properties. In the example, above, each car might be a particular make and model. To distinguish it using their company cars of the same kind, it will also use a unique serial number. Thus, the home could possibly be serial number, and the need for that property is definitely the car’s serial number.
* Entity relationships: An entity can also get a partnership with some other entities. Maybe the showroom as well as the north lot are two entities. Thus, an automobile within the showroom may have a partnership together with the showroom, as that is certainly the location where the car can be found.
As another demonstration of an ER diagram, each salesperson who works well with this auto dealer is likewise an entity. Obviously, one property on this salesperson will be a name. If a salesperson sold the auto, then there ought to be the capability setting that kind of relationship using the vehicle.
Using ER Diagram Markdown
When designers first lay out to organize a database, they must collect the data they need along with the relationships between various information. They should know which entities to include. For every single entity, they will have to set properties along with the relationships between other entities. This model enables them to create a graphical representation with this in ways that is simple to convey, understand, and also to create databases from.
For example, an application company may work with a car dealership to create a personal computer system on their behalf. The car dealer might not have much technical expertise but will be able to understand this diagram with just a bit of coaching. In turn, the software developers may well not know all of the information of running a car dealership. When finalizing the design and style, it’s crucial that you include both technical people and company owners to make certain that the applying can have the data that it requires to serve as its intended.
The dealer can study the diagram and offer missing pieces without really understanding database concepts. It’s far better to iron out this kind of thing prior to actually creating the database or designing systems around it. That’s only one explanation why this sort of graphical representation works so well. Other benefits include the ability to make use of the model to generate the ultimate database and also to consult it later as focus on the application progresses.
Obtain ER Diagram Markdown
See more complicated examples of ER Diagram Markdown to be able to fully discover how to create this important document. It’s very easy to download them on this internet site. This kind of tool is fairly easy to understand, nevertheless it can serve as one of the most powerful tools for database and computer system designers.